A trip around the Glenmore Reservoir in Calgary. We will meet around 9:00AM at the Heritage Boat Launch. We will unload and then hit the water. We paddle past Heritage park and the paddle wheeler Moyie. As we approach Weaselhead Flats where the Elbow enters, we should see some birds and moose have been known to make an appearance. Expect 4-5 hours of paddling |

Touring Kayak - Typically 12 feet long or more and 24" wide or less, with front and rear water tight compartments for flotation and storage, defined keel Rec Kayak - Typically less than 12 feet long, often greater than 24" wide, with one or no water tight compartments, may or may not have a keel Whitewater Kayak - Typically less than 10', no watertight compartments, no keel |
